![]() Title:Simulation of a Fixed-Magnitude Data Poisoning Attack in a Federated Learning Distributed Model Authors:Maciej Kuczynski Conference:ISD2026 Tags:federated learning, machine learning, mobile devices, poisoning attack and proof of concept Abstract: The abstract summarizes a Proof of Concept (PoC) of measuring the impact of stealth data poisoning with a fixed magnitude on a federated machine learning model. The model is created in Tensorflow Lite and is used to predict the strength of the mobile network. It operates on four physical mobile devices running the Android operating system, each representing a different mobile network. The experiment demonstrates the hardware and software setup (including limitations applied), initial results of accuracy and loss measurements, and indicates potential improvements for the future.
